§ 4016. Appeal
(a)Any person aggrieved by any action of the Commissioner may obtain a review by appeal to the Superior Court of Washington County. The appeal shall be based on the record of the proceedings before the Commissioner and shall not be limited to questions of law. If the appeal is from an order of the Commissioner, the order shall not take effect during the pendency of the appeal unless the court determines otherwise.
(b)The court may review all the facts and in disposing of any issue before it may modify, affirm, or reverse any order of the Commissioner in whole or in part.
(c)Either party may appeal from the decision of the Superior Court to the Supreme Court in the manner provided by law. (Recodified and amended 2025, No. 11, § 2, eff. September 1, 2025.)
